Mandino is the most widely read inspirational and self-help author in the world and also the author of 18 books with total sales of more than 36 million copies sold in 22 languages.

interesting
I found this book on this website, and ordered it through curiosity. However, I found it disappointing. The writing style seemed hurried and careless, and somehow didn't convince. I read 'The Way of the Peaceful Warrior' by Dan Millman a few years ago, and found that a much more affecting and powerful book. If you enjoyed this book, try D. Millman for comparison. Both involve the theme of a mysterious mentor figure who changes the course of the protagonist's life, however The Way.. is a deeper and more satisfying book. I can trully say it changed my life.
